During the
 
               summertime at Hunter Reservoir highs are mostly in the 70's. During the moonlight hours it's commonly in the 30's. Through the wintertime this place gets highs in the 20's; all through the dark hours in the winter at Hunter Reservoir temperatures fall to the-10's. This lake is so wonderful. Wolf Creek
25 miles away
3 PHOTOS
Wolf Creek is renowned for light, fluffy powder that comes in epic portions.In addition to a variety of traditionally maintained beginner and intermediate terrain, Wolf Creek offers an exceptional back-country feel with 1,000 acres of advanced and expert terrain serviced by the Alberta lift, including the breathtaking Knife Ridge, the challenging Waterfall Area, and Alberta Peak, the pinnacle of Wolf Creek Ski Area, all of which exists largely in its natural state.....
After a snow-filled December, Wolf Creek Ski Area has surpassed the 200-inch mark, making it the ski resort with the Most Snow in the Nation! With sun-filled days and not another storm coming in for at least a week, this is the best time to discover why boarders and skiers alike have coveted the deep powder and incredible natural snow in Southwest Colorado....
